Some pedals track much better than others. Digital octavers track better than analogue in the main, but digital ones usually have a bit of latency compared to analogue.
There are certain common dead spots on Fender-style basses, with C-Eb on the G string being the worst offenders; these cause tracking to be fairly iffy.
The best-tracking analogue octavers I’ve tried are the MXR Vintage Bass Octave and Bass Octave Deluxe; Red Witch Zeus was also pretty close.
